Transaction d947232039ca225a58bd0c56afb23500e3e4aa2976f76b2ddc36cb9a7a64fca2
1 Input
1 Output
-
d947232039ca225a58bd0c56afb23500e3e4aa2976f76b2ddc36cb9a7a64fca2:0
- value
- 1376384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1b72ce67064b7d886775837f18b400c11101a9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L7sfLq2ecQWpzkSSeoYQt6Sp8KqAkxLi3